Description |
This action configures the proxy settings for Microsoft Edge. If this policy is enabled, Microsoft Edge ignores all proxy-related options specified from the command line. If this policy is not configured, users can choose their own proxy settings. This policy overrides the following individual policies: - ProxyMode - ProxyPacUrl - ProxyServer - ProxyBypassList Setting the ProxySettings policy accepts the following fields: - ProxyMode, which allows for the proxy server used by Microsoft Edge to be specified and prevents users from changing proxy settings. - ProxyPacUrl, a URL to a proxy .pac file. - ProxyServer, a URL for the proxy server. - ProxyBypassList, a list of proxy hosts that Microsoft Edge bypasses. For ProxyMode, the following values have the noted impact: - direct, a proxy is never used and all other fields are ignored. - system, the system's proxy is used and all other fields are ignored. - auto_detect, all other fields are ignored. - fixed_servers, the ProxyServer and ProxyBypassList fields are used. - pac_script, the ProxyPacUrl and ProxyBypassList fields are used. |

Check Text (C-38938r1007482_chk) |
The policy value for "Computer Configuration/Administrative Templates/Microsoft Edge/Proxy server/Proxy Settings" must be “Enabled”, and have a “Proxy Settings” value defined for "ProxyMode". "ProxyMode" must be defined and set to one of the following: "direct", "system", "auto_detect", "fixed_servers", or "pac_script". Consult Microsoft documentaion for proper configuration of the text string required to define the "Proxy Settings" value. Example: {"ProxyMode": "fixed_servers", "ProxyServer": "123.123.123.123:8080"} Values for "ProxyPacUrl", "ProxyServer", or "ProxyBypassList" are optional. Use the Windows Registry Editor to navigate to the following key: HKLM\SOFTWARE\Policies\Microsoft\Edge If the REG_SZ value for "ProxySettings" does not have "ProxyMode" configured, this is a finding. |
Fix Text (F-38901r1007483_fix) |
Set the policy value for "Computer Configuration/Administrative Templates/Microsoft Edge/Proxy server/Proxy Settings" to "Enabled" and define a value for "ProxyMode". "ProxyMode" must be defined and set to one of the following: "direct", "system", "auto_detect", "fixed_servers", or "pac_script". Consult Microsoft documentaion for proper configuration of the text string required to define the "Proxy Settings" value. Example: {"ProxyMode": "fixed_servers", "ProxyServer": "123.123.123.123:8080"} "ProxyPacUrl", "ProxyServer", or "ProxyBypassList" are optional. |
